[1] In Soviet times, the station served as a stopping point for some long-distance passenger trains.
Later on, only local electric commuter trains called at the station.
Because the long-distance trains did not stop here anymore, Dagomys suffered from the reduction of the number of tourists.
[citation needed] As of 2014, all local trains connecting Sochi and Tuapse via Lazarevskaya called at Dagomys, while long-distance trains did not stop.
In 2013, construction of a new station building and modern terminals began for the upcoming 2014 Winter Olympics.
